'''Gorilla Pirates'''<ref>The name comes from [[Rayman 2: The Great Escape : Le Guide Officiel|the official French guide of ''Rayman 2'']] and early ''Rayman 2'' artworks<br>http://raymanpc.com/wiki/images/6/62/Gorilla_Pirate_and_Spyglass_Pirate_names_source.jpg<br>http://raymanpc.com/wiki/script-en/images/a/a7/R2_Portraitdefamille.jpg</ref> are powerful [[Robo-Pirate]]s which appear in ''[[Rayman 2]]'', and are notable for being [[Resistance|invincible]]. They also make a cameo appearance on a production line in the [[Electric Final]] race course in ''[[Rayman M]]'' and, together with many other [[Robo-Pirate]]s, in the [[Hoodlum Headquarters]] in ''[[Rayman 3]]''.

In many ways, Gorilla Pirates seem like a stereotypical first-mate [[Robo-Pirate|pirate]], comparable in apparel to Mr Smee from Disney's ''Peter Pan''. Gorilla Pirates are brainless and exist only to clobber intruders in their territory. They are short, stubby, and carry a hunchback. They are seen wearing a blue and white striped shirt. They walk on all fours like a gorilla. According to the official ''[[Rayman 2]]'' website, their IQ is somewhere between that of a deep-sea sponge and a slice of toast.<ref>Official ''Rayman 2'' website, ''Charaktere'', http://web.archive.org/web/20001002215808/www.rayman2.com/all/good/characters/characters.html</ref>

Gorilla Pirates attack in only one way: they charge suddenly, run over their foe, and retreat to their initial position. Unfortunately for them, their lack of intelligence does not stop them where their foe jumps, and so if [[Rayman]] jumps right next to a cliff, the Gorilla Pirate is likely to fall off and explode. [[Rayman]] can also lure them over into pools of water, in this case, they will fall in and be electrocuted prior to exploding.

Another way to neutralise a Gorilla Pirate is to incapacitate them by lobbing a [[plum]] at its head. This technique can also be used to gain access to otherwise unreachable ledges, as it immobilises the Gorilla Pirate, allowing his plum-encased head to be used as a platform. Both of these techniques were previously available and useful when applied to the [[Livingstone]]s in [[Rayman 1|the original ''Rayman'' game]].

In ''[[Rayman M]]'' and ''[[Rayman Arena]]'', Gorilla Pirates can be seen on an assembly in the [[Electric Final]] level, this could suggest that the level actually takes place in a [[Robo-Pirate]] manufacturing facility. Different looking Gorilla Pirates can also be seen in the level, these lack arms, their feet and legs differ, and the hole in their shirt is on the left, as opposed to the right.

In ''[[Rayman 3]]'', Gorilla Pirates can be found in a secret located within the third level of the [[Hoodlum Headquarters]]. They, alongside [[Razorbeard]], some [[Red Henchman 800|Red Henchmen 800]] and [[Spyglass Pirate]]s, are set out in a manner evocative of ''[https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Last_Supper_(Leonardo_da_Vinci) The Last Supper]'' by Leonardo da Vinci.
